The Broomhandle was introduced in 1896, it must have been a shock wave in the business back then. Going up against people armed with SA revolvers with a gun that loads ten off a stripper as fast as you can push with your thumb. Yank the stripper out and the bolt closes on a fresh round. It's small wonder they were so popular back then.
